The City of Tuscaloosa will host a public input meeting on Sept. 29 from 5-5:45 pm in the Daugherty Room in City Hall to discuss the temporary closing of 4th Avenue East.

The meeting, designed to provide an opportunity for citizens to express ideas and concerns to the Office of the City Engineer and the Tuscaloosa Department of Transportation, will serve as part of the evaluation of the road closure.

4th Avenue East has been closed since Aug. 27, at the request of homeowners in the area.
